The head of flight of the Russian segment explained a situation with food on ISS
Moscow, 19 January - Federal state unitary enterprise RAMI "RIA Novosti". The situation with food of the Russian astronauts onboard the International Space Station (ISS) does not cause any questions, the head of flight of the Russian segment of station Vladimir Solovyev told to journalists. Earlier with reference to negotiations of crew of station with the Center of management situated near Moscow by flight it was reported that the American side transferred to astronauts of 13 food allowances.
